Construction paper, also known as sugar paper, is coloured cardstock paper.
What material is construction paper?
wood pulp
Construction paper is a type of paper stock created from wood pulp that is typically a tough, coarse, fibrous, colored paper.

Why do they call it construction paper?
The term construction paper likely has its roots in the classroom, where the making-of-things and where learning how-things-are-made were closely linked to the use of educational colored papers.

What paper type is construction paper?
Construction paper, also known as sugar paper, is coloured cardstock paper. The texture is slightly rough, and the surface is unfinished. Due to the source material, mainly wood pulp, small particles are visible on the paper’s surface. It is used for projects or crafts.

What is the difference between paper and construction paper?
Construction paper is not much thicker than regular printer paper. Because it is thin, it can be easy to tear and won’t be able to handle heavier materials or hot glue. Liquid glue sometimes will bleed through as well. It’s best to stick to regular glue sticks when using construction paper.

What is building paper called?
house wrap
Building paper, also called house wrap, is a strong, fibrous paper that blocks water and moisture from entering from the outside but allows moist air to pass through from the inside, preventing a buildup of moisture inside walls that can lead to mold.

What size is construction paper?
The most commonly found size for construction paper is 9″x12″. However, you can also find other sizes on the market, including 12″x18″, 18″x24″, and 24″x36″.

What paper weight is construction paper?
Virtually all construction papers are described as “heavyweight” paper, and they range in basis weight from 65 to 80 lb. The 80-lb paper gives its ISO weight as 120-130 gsm, so using the above chart, we can estimate that the lower weights are around 100 gsm.
